Transaction f66eaa504ebce628b1776a699f77d1fa536cfd316ca3807314ccfa8117c1ebca

87 Input
2 Outputs
  • f66eaa504ebce628b1776a699f77d1fa536cfd316ca3807314ccfa8117c1ebca:0
  • value  1040485708
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• f66eaa504ebce628b1776a699f77d1fa536cfd316ca3807314ccfa8117c1ebca:1
  • value  1093189
    address  357gYrP9ji9agVYdPLk3YD1xapxzCXAu2x